📌 ### 📌 Financial Risk Manager JOB VACANCY ANNOUNCEMENT BANK OF AFRICA – RWANDA is a private commercial Bank that operates in Rwanda serving businesses/entities and individuals. BANK OF AFRICA started its operations in Rwanda in October 2015 after the acquisition of AGASEKE BANK that had been operating in Rwanda since November 2003. BANK OF AFRICA – RWANDA is part of BANK OF AFRICA BMCE Group which opened doors in 1982 From Bamako/Mali, The Bank is present in 19 countries, including 8 in West Africa (Benin, Burkina Faso, Côte d’Ivoire, Ghana, Mali, Niger, Togo and Senegal), 8 in East Africa and the Indian Ocean zone (Burundi, Djibouti, Ethiopia, Kenya, Madagascar, Uganda, Rwanda, Tanzania), 2 in central Africa (The Democratic Republic of Congo and Congo) and France. The BOA Group network of 18 commercial banks, 1 global holding company, 2 regional holding companies, 1 investment company, 2 technical support subsidiaries, 2 IT processing and support companies, and 1 representative office in Addis Ababa. In Rwanda, the bank now has 15 branches, including 9 branches in Kigali and 6 branches upcountry. (Muhanga, Huye, Musanze, Rubavu, Rusizi and Kayonza) and 1 outlet in Kigali at Milles Collines Hotel. Job Purpose Reporting to the Executive Head of Risk, the Financial Risk Manager is responsible for identifying, measuring, monitoring, and controlling liquidity and financial risks, while ensuring that the bank’s risk management policies, frameworks, and methodologies are properly developed, implemented, and maintained in line with regulatory requirements and the Bank’s Risk Appetite. II. Key Responsibilities: 1. Risk Appetite & Limit Framework Lead and coordinate the development of the Bank’s Risk Appetite limits for Board approval. Monitor adherence to approved limits and recommend corrective actions where necessary. 2. Risk Management Frameworks Develop and lead the drafting of the following risk management documents: ICAAP, ILAAP, Recovery Plan, and Risk Management Framework. Ensure timely approval of these documents and their submission to the Central Bank within regulatory timelines. Lead the identification of material risks and ensure their adequate reflection in capital and liquidity planning. Coordinate inputs from Finance, Treasury, Business, and other key departments. 3. Stress Testing & Scenario Analysis Design and perform liquidity and financial stress tests and scenario analyses. Support ICAAP, ILAAP, and Recovery Plan processes with forward-looking risk assessments. Assess the impact of adverse scenarios on capital, liquidity, and profitability, including reverse stress testing where applicable. 4. New Products & Business Support Conduct risk assessments for new products and services and provide risk opinion for the Product Approval Committee. Advise business units on risk mitigation and structural enhancements. 5. Financial Risk Monitoring Identify, measure, and monitor financial risk exposures that may impact capital adequacy, liquidity, and the balance sheet structure. Assess the impact of financial conditions on earnings and capital. Establish, monitor, and report financial risk limits and escalate breaches where necessary. 6. Risk Policies & Framework Development Draft and develop new risk policies and management documents for the Bank. Ensure effective implementation and communication of approved policies across the Bank. Periodically review policies to reflect regulatory and strategic changes. 7. Liquidity Risk Management Monitor the bank’s liquidity position and funding profile. Calculate and report liquidity metrics (LCR, NSFR, liquidity gaps). Conduct liquidity stress testing and maintain the Contingency Funding Plan (CFP). 8. Risk Culture & Continuous Improvement Promote a strong risk culture and awareness across the Bank. Provide training and guidance on financial risk policies and practices. Continuously enhance risk tools, models, and reporting capabilities. 9. Reporting & Governance Prepare high-quality risk reports for the Risk Management Committees. Present risk assessments, policy proposals, and key risk issues to governance committees.
